Personal data Hillechien Alberts 

  • She was born on April 17, 1868 in Zuidlaren, Drenthe, Nederland.Source 1
    Zuidlaren Geboorte 18-04-1868 13 Hillechien Alberts Kind

    Geboorte, Zuidlaren, 18-04-1868, aktenummer 13

    Kind: Hillechien Alberts,
    geboren te Zuidlaren op 17-04-1868,
    dochter van Willem Alberts, beroep: landbouwer; oud: 31 jaar, en Geesje Luis, beroep: zonder.
  • Profession: Dienstmeid.Source 1
  • She died on April 8, 1954 in Zuidlaren, Drenthe, Nederland, she was 85 years old.Source 1
    Zuidlaren Overlijden 09-04-1954 31 Hillechien Alberts Overledene Boer

    Overlijden (Overlijden), Zuidlaren, 09-04-1954, aktenummer 31

    Overleden: Hillechien Alberts;
    geboren te Zuidlaren; beroep: zonder,
    overleden op 08-04-1954 te Zuidlaren; oud: 85 jaar,
    dochter van Willem Alberts en Geesje Luis.

    Gehuwd geweest met: Pieter Boer (overleden;Overleden echtgenoot).

Household of Hillechien Alberts

She is married to Pieter Boer.

They got married on September 16, 1893 at Zuidlaren, Drenthe, Nederland, she was 25 years old.Source 1

Zuidlaren Huwelijk 16-09-1893 18 Hillechien Alberts Bruid Boer

Huwelijk, Zuidlaren, 16-09-1893, aktenummer 18

Bruidegom: Pieter Boer,
geboren te Anloo; leeftijd: 31 jaar; beroep: molenaarsknecht,
zoon van Hindrik Boer, beroep: arbeider en Hinderika Niezing, beroep: arbeider

Bruid: Hillechien Alberts,
geboren te Zuidlaren; leeftijd: 25; beroep: dienstmeid,
dochter van Willem Alberts, beroep: arbeider en Geesje Luis.

NB:
moeder bruid overleden.

Child(ren):

  1. Hinderika Boer  1894-????
  2. Willem Boer  1896-1982
  3. Geesje Boer  1898-????
